This year, the Biomedical Engineering Society (BMES) is hosting our first ever Biomed Boot Camp, where 7th and 8th graders from across Fort Collins will visit our workshops on biomedical engineering, allowing the students to gain a hands-on experience and see what biomed is all about!

BMES is accepting the first 30 participants into this FREE program! To sign up fill out this form: bit.ly/biomedbootcamp

We’ll have a number of activities, including Arduino EKG, Magnetic Slime, Artery Clot Experiment, and a Muscle Car Demonstration!
